PM Narendra Modi to inaugurate 3rd AIIB annual meeting 2018

Prime Minister Narendra Modi. (Photo: AFP/File)

Prime Minister Narendra Modi will inaugurate the third annual meeting of Asian Infrastructure Investment Bank (AIIB) on June 25-26. The two-day meeting will be hosted by the Department of Economic Affairs, Ministry of Finance, in Mumbai.

In the past, AIIB annual meetings were held at Beijing, China, and Jeju in 2016, Republic of Korea in 2017.

What is AIIB?

The Asian Infrastructure Investment Bank (AIIB) is a multilateral development bank with a mission to improve social and economic outcomes in Asia and beyond. Headquartered in Beijing, AIIB commenced operations in January 2016 and have now grown to 86 approved members from around the world.

The theme for this year’s meeting is “Mobilizing Finance for Infrastructure: Innovation and Collaboration” that will see leaders from varied organisations and levels of government to share ideas and experiences for creating a sustainable future through sound infrastructure investment.

The two-day meeting will witness the presence of top policy makers, Ministers from AIIB member countries, participants from partner institutions, the private sector and civil society organisations.

Interim Finance Minister Piyush Goyal and Secretary, Department of Economic Affairs Subhash Chandra Garg will be present during the course of the meeting, to discuss the environmental landscape of investing in infrastructure plans in India and also share an overview about the third annual meeting.

In the run up to the annual meeting 2018, the Government of India has organised a number of events in different cities in India from February to June 2018, aimed to stimulate debates on several important themes of infrastructure.

This year will also see the launch of the inaugural Asian Infrastructure Forum, which will gather infrastructure practitioners in a practical and project-driven discourse, focused on matching innovative finance to critical infrastructure needs.

During the AIIB Annual Meeting, the government of India would hold number of events aim to capture the critical dimensions of infrastructure financing and panel discussion with Chief Ministers on vision of infrastructure development in India.

The Department of Economic Affairs, Ministry of Finance, in partnership with the Federation of Indian Chambers of Commerce & Industry (FICCI), is also organising an exhibition “India Infrastructure Expo 2018” that will run in parallel to the third Annual Meeting of the Asian Infrastructure Investment Bank.

The objective of the exhibition is to offer companies from the public and private sector to showcase their latest solutions, technologies and offerings in the realm of infrastructure project development and delivery.
